lanky |
| |
| ADJECTIVE: | 1. Tall, thin, and awkwardly built: gangling, gangly, rangy, spindling, spindly. See FAT. 2. Having little flesh or fat on the body: angular, bony, fleshless, gaunt, lank, lean2, meager, rawboned, scrawny, skinny, slender, slim, spare, thin, twiggy, weedy. Idioms: all skin and bones, thin as a rail. See FAT.
